Suspend a copper wire in a solution of silver nitrate. Over the course of a few hours the silver nitrate will convert to copper II nitrate, turning the solution blue. Elemental silver will precipitate.

When silver nitrate is added to copper, a redox reaction occurs where the Cu from copper displaces the Ag from silver nitrate. This results in the formation of copper nitrate and silver metal as a solid precipitate.
